配置Linux云服务器桌面环境通常涉及安装图形界面如GNOME或KDE,启用远程桌面服务如VNC或RDP,并确保防火墙允许相应端口。
Linux云服务器桌面环境配置
在云计算时代,许多企业和开发者选择使用Linux云服务器来部署应用程序和服务,为了方便管理和操作,配置一个图形化的桌面环境是很有必要的,本文将介绍如何在Linux云服务器上配置桌面环境。
准备工作
1、确保你的Linux云服务器已经安装了图形界面相关的软件包,对于基于Debian的系统(如Ubuntu),可以使用以下命令安装:
sudo apt-get update sudo apt-get install xorg openbox obmenu
对于基于RHEL的系统(如CentOS),可以使用以下命令安装:
sudo yum groupinstall "GNOME Desktop" "Graphical Administration Tools"
2、确保你的Linux云服务器已经安装了VNC服务器,VNC服务器可以让你通过远程连接来访问图形界面,对于基于Debian的系统(如Ubuntu),可以使用以下命令安装:
sudo apt-get install tightvncserver
对于基于RHEL的系统(如CentOS),可以使用以下命令安装:
sudo yum install tigervnc-server
配置VNC服务器
1、修改VNC服务器配置文件,对于基于Debian的系统(如Ubuntu),配置文件位于/etc/tightvnc/xstartup
,对于基于RHEL的系统(如CentOS),配置文件位于/etc/sysconfig/vncservers
。
2、在配置文件中,设置桌面环境的启动命令,对于基于Debian的系统(如Ubuntu),可以设置如下:
exec /etc/X11/Xsession
对于基于RHEL的系统(如CentOS),可以设置如下:
exec /bin/bash -l
3、重启VNC服务器以使配置生效,对于基于Debian的系统(如Ubuntu),可以使用以下命令重启:
sudo systemctl restart vncserver@:1.service
对于基于RHEL的系统(如CentOS),可以使用以下命令重启:
sudo systemctl restart vncserver@:1.service
远程连接桌面环境
1、使用VNC客户端(如RealVNC、TightVNC或TigerVNC)连接到Linux云服务器的VNC服务,连接地址为:服务器IP地址:5901
(其中5901
是VNC服务的默认端口,可以根据实际情况进行修改)。
2、输入VNC服务器的密码进行验证,这个密码是在安装VNC服务器时设置的。
3、成功连接后,你将看到Linux云服务器的桌面环境,在此环境中,你可以像在本地计算机上一样操作和管理Linux云服务器。
相关问题与解答
1、Q: Linux云服务器上的桌面环境有哪些?
A: Linux云服务器上的桌面环境有很多种,如GNOME、KDE、XFCE等,具体选择哪种桌面环境取决于你的需求和喜好。
2、Q: 为什么要使用VNC服务器来访问Linux云服务器的桌面环境?
A: VNC服务器可以让你通过远程连接来访问图形界面,方便在任何地方对Linux云服务器进行管理和操作。
3、Q: 如何提高Linux云服务器桌面环境的安全性?
A: 为了提高Linux云服务器桌面环境的安全性,可以为VNC服务器设置强密码,限制允许连接的IP地址范围,以及使用SSH隧道进行加密传输。
4、Q: 如何在Linux云服务器上配置多个桌面环境?
A: 在Linux云服务器上配置多个桌面环境,可以为每个桌面环境创建一个独立的VNC服务实例,并设置不同的端口号,然后在客户端使用不同的端口号连接到不同的桌面环境。
原创文章,作者:酷盾叔,如若转载,请注明出处:https://www.kdun.com/ask/295514.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复